Can i control the name of the column headers in a timechart using the by

I have a search

...| timechart span=1h sum(kpi1) as Name1 by LABEL

This gives a 2 column output with _time and LABEL1 as there headers.

How Can I control the value LABEL1 of the header for the colum to be something else?

I have tried doing ...| strcat LABEL "-ALT" LABEL_ALT | timechart span=1h sum(kpi1) as Name1 by LABEL_ALT but this seem to divide the values in the `LABEL1 by 2 which is not what I want, maybe it is something to do with the data format.

this works, if LABEL1 is the column header

...| timechart span=1h sum(kpi1) as Name1 by LABEL | rename LABEL1 as test123
